The Rice Owls (8-12) are traveling to Minges Coliseum on Wednesday where they will try to beat the East Carolina Pirates (6-14).

The Rice Owls stepped onto the hardwood against Tulsa and took a loss by a final of 87-81 in their last contest. Concerning fouls, the Owls ended up finishing with 22 and Tulsa racked up 15 fouls. They also buried 11 of 25 tries from long range. Tulsa finished the game shooting 78.6% at the charity stripe by burying 22 of their 28 tries. Furthermore, Tulsa totaled 29 rebounds (12 offensive, 17 defensive), but wasn't able to record a rejection. Tulsa doled out 11 assists and had 10 steals in this matchup. In relation to defense, Rice let their opponent shoot 48.2% from the field on 27 of 56 shooting. They also distributed 13 dimes in this matchup while forcing 10 turnovers and having 6 steals. When it comes to hauling in rebounds, they earned 27 with 8 of them being of the offensive variety. At the charity stripe, the Owls converted 9 of 14 tries for a rate of 64.3%. Rice wrapped up the game with a 50.0% FG percentage (30 of 60) and buried 12 of their 26 shots from beyond the arc.
Jalen Smith is one player who was important for the game. He went 60.0% from the floor and recorded 2 assists. He was on the court for 32 mins played but concluded the game with no rebounds. He racked up 24 points on 9 of 15 shooting.

Rice steps onto the court with a win-loss record of 8-12 on the year. They turn it over 12.3 times per game and as a team they commit 18.6 personal fouls on a nightly basis. As a team, Rice is pulling in 37.4 rebounds per game and has accumulated 244 assists so far this season, which has them ranked 319th in college hoops in terms of passing. The Owls are shooting 36.6% on three-point attempts (178 of 486) and 69.4% from the charity stripe. They average 74.1 pts per contest (243rd in college) while shooting 42.4% from the floor.

When they are on defense, the Owls are forcing 12.3 turnovers per contest while drawing 17.9 fouls. They are 77th in college in giving up assists to the opposition with 243 conceded on the season. The Owls defense is giving up a FG percentage of 44.0% (510 of 1,160) and they relinquish 36.4 rebounds per game as a team. They are surrendering 34.8% on shots from distance and they are ranked 199th in the nation in opponents PPG (74.0).
When they last stepped on the court, the East Carolina Pirates got the victory with a final of 63-59 when they faced North Texas. When discussing team rebounding, East Carolina allowed North Texas to grab 23 overall (8 offensive). They finished 20.0% from 3-point land by going 4 out of 20 and ended up shooting 11 out of 16 at the free throw line (68.8%). The Pirates permitted North Texas to knock down 22 of 63 attempts from the field which left them shooting 34.9% for this contest. When the game finished, the Pirates shot 20 for 47 from the field which gave them a shooting percentage of 42.6%. In regard to three-point shots, East Carolina made 6 of their 16 tries (37.5%). They were able to make 17 of the free throws for a rate of 73.9%. North Texas earned 18 personal fouls in the game which got the Pirates to the free throw line for 23 attempts. They also turned the ball over 15 times, while getting 4 steals in this matchup. The Pirates pulled down 28 defensive boards and 11 offensive boards totaling 39 for the contest.
Jordan Riley was important for the Pirates in this matchup. He tallied 15 points in his 39 mins of playing time and totaled 2 assists for the contest. He made 3 of 12 in this game for a field goal rate of 25.0%, and had 5 rebounds.
East Carolina has a mark of 6-14 for the campaign. The Pirates commit 16.5 personal fouls per contest and they connect on 68.7% from the charity stripe. They are assisting teammates 11.1 times per contest (346th in college) and they are giving up possession 12.9 times per game. East Carolina has totaled 1,358 points for the year (67.9 per game) and they average 36.5 boards per contest. As an offense, the Pirates are connecting on 40.3% from the field, which ranks them 349th in D-1.
The Pirates on the defensive side of the court are 245th in college in PPG allowed with 76.2. They are able to force 11.8 turnovers per game and have allowed teams to shoot 44.8% from the field (243rd in college hoops). The East Carolina defense gives up 35.5% on shots from beyond the arc (167 of 471) and opponents are converting on 73.6% of their free throw attempts. They give up 14.3 assists and 35.8 total rebounds per game, which is ranked 252nd and 259th in D-1.
